Never Invulnerable
Lots of homeowners of South Carolina incorrectly believe that they're invulnerable to bedbugs, since they clean their houses each and every day. Although this might assist them eradicate roaches, it will have really little effect, if any, on bedbugs. What customers stopped working to comprehend is that the bed bugs in Charleston are not brought on by unkemptness. They're not attracted to breadcrumbs or potato chip remnants on your floor. Rather, they're attracted to your blood!Usually, residential establishments, which have a high turnover, are far more most likely to end up being infested by bedbugs. This consists of homes, dormitories, hotels, cruise ships, refugee camps, and homeless shelters. However, nobody and no home is invulnerable. Unless you live within a bubble or on a deserted, you might really well become affected by bedbugs. Since these bugs are extensive and do not feed off of dirt and food debris, you need to not feel embarrassed by your current circumstance. How Problem Occurs
Once again, bedbugs are not attracted to food, dirt, or dirt crumbs. Rather, they're much comparable to a contagious illness. They're really passed from one person to the next. Acquiring utilized clothing or furniture can lead directly to a problem. At the same time, spending a night within a motel or hotel could result in a problem. Lastly, if you permit somebody that is handling bedbugs to enter your home, you might likewise end up being a victim. These critters travel in travel luggage, on furniture, and within clothing. Nymph
A nymph or young bedbug's body is transparent in color, so they are a bit more challenging to see. Their abdominal areas will grow somewhat large and turn bright red due to the blood material once they feed. Throughout the young bedbugs' life, it will need to need to shed its skin up to 5 times, before becoming an adult. It will reach the adult years in a much quicker manner if the nymph is capable of gaining access to fresh blood on a regular basis. It may take a nymph with regular feedings anywhere from 4 to 9 weeks to become an adult.Nighttime Qualities
A bedbug exhibits nocturnal qualities, however they are not genuinely nocturnal. The term nighttime essentially means that everything is done during the night. Even though bedbugs frequently feed upon their host at night, it is not uncommon for them to feed throughout the daytime hours, also.
